Planning a Toilet Replacement in Tampa

A toilet replacement typically doesn't require a permit in Tampa, which simplifies planning. However, always confirm with the local building department before starting, especially for structural changes. Expect the project to take 2-4 hours to complete.

This is a beginner-friendly project that many Tampa homeowners tackle themselves. DIY can save you roughly $221 in labor costs, though you'll still need to source materials at local prices (material index: 108).
